THE COMPOSITION OF SOME NITRATO NITROSYLRUTHENIUM COMPLEXES

Journal Article · · J. Inorg. & Nuclear Chem.
Isolation and analysis of some of the nitrato complexes of nitrosylruthenium existing in nitric acid solutions has permitted identification of the complexes. The complex that is most extractable in tri-n-butyl phosphate (TBP) was shown to be trinitrato nitrosylruthenium STARuNO(NO/sub 3/)/sub 3/ (H/ sub 2/O)/sub w2/!; other extractable species contained fewer than three nitrato groups. Three cationic species, which were isolated by ion exchange techniques, were shown to be dinitrato, mononitrato, and nonnitrato nitrosylruthenium with the probable formuias STARuNO(NO/sub 3/)/sub3/H/sub 2/O) /sub 3/!/sup +/, STARuNO(NO/sub 3/) (H/sub 2/O)/sub 4!/sup 2+, and STARuNO(H/sub 2/O)/sub 5/!/sup 3+/ respectively. A study of the complexes adsorbed by anion exchange resins indicated the absorbed species to be a mixture of complexes some of which contained more than three nitrato groups per ruthenium atom.
